APPEON POWERBUILDER
PowerBuilder 2022 è ora disponibile!
Più Produttività, Più Securezza, Più Compatibilità
Tabbed Code Editor
L’IDE PowerBuilder ha adesso un nuovo layout tabbed, che permette di sfruttare meglio lo spiazio del tuo monitor e rende più facile lavorare con oggetti multipli.
Salta agli oggetti
Seleziona la referenza ad un oggetto in qualunque dichiarazione o segmento di codice e salta istantaneamente alla classe di oggetti referenziata (con il suo painter specifico).
Quick Search del codice
Naviga fino allo script relativo usando le “espressioni” di ricerca dal dialogo di ricerca nel system tree. E’ stato introdotto anche il filtering in vari painter di oggetti, come ad esempio i dialoghi SaveAs e Select Tables.
Customizzazione degli UI Themes più rapida
Lo stile dell’oggetto base window/user verrà applicato automaticamente agli oggetti windows/user discendenti senza definizioni di stile extra. Puoi applicare automaticamente lo stile ai medesimi tipi di controlli in un oggetto user e window.
Per la sicurezza
Autenticazione Two-Way TLS
Sia il server che il client possono autenticarsi reciprocamente, permettendo la connessione solo agli utenti autorizzati. L’autenticazione Two-way TLS è supportata per tutte le richieste HTTP, incluse quelle dei token di sicurezza e le chiamate alle Web API REST.
Aggiornamento del protocollo HTTP
I più recenti protocolli HTTP/2 e TLS 1.3 offronto una migliore sicurezza ed una migliore performance. Questi protocolli sono supportati per tutte le richieste HTTP, incluse quelle dei security token e le chiamate alle Web API REST.
- Conversione automatica al Cloud
- Compilazione con versioni di runtime multiple
- Installazione automatica delle app
- Integrazione con Apache ECharts
- Integrazione con JavaScript
- Microsoft UI Automation
- Miglioramenti nell’integrazione Git
- Nuovo driver SQL Server
- per valutare la nuova capacità di implementazione del Cloud di PowerBuilder 2021 sarà necessario installare anche PowerServer 2021.
- PowerBuilder 2021 può coesistere con versioni precedenti.
San Francisco, 22 Gennaio 2021
Appeon, produttore di software per accelerare lo sviluppo di applicazioni business, ha oggi annunciato la disponibilità di PowerBuilder 2019 R3.
Questa release offre una nuova eccezionale tecnologia di installazione delle applicazioni chiamata PowerClient.
PowerClient automatizza in tutta sicurezza l’installazione e l’aggiornamento delle applicazioni client via HTTPS, e supporta sia i progetti di tipo client/server sia quelli di tipo cloud.
Questa tecnologia apre la strada alla possibilità di creare con PowerBuilder delle Installable Cloud Apps (applicazioni installabili via Internet con architettura cloud nativa). Per supportare la creazione veloce di strumenti cloud utilizzando la famiglia di prodotti PowerBuilder, è stato oltremodo potenziato il .NET DataStore con funzionalità asincrone, con varie utilità di generazione di codice, di debug avanzato, e con il supporto dei database cloud Amazon Aurora e Azure Cloud.
Oltre a molte altre importanti funzionalità, PowerBuilder 2019 R3 è una versione con long-term support (LTS), e sostituisce le precedenti versioni LTS.
Novità
PowerBuilder 2019 R3 include i seguenti miglioramenti chiave per PowerScript e i progetti C#:
Miglioramenti nello sviluppo PowerScript
- Installazione Automatizzata – PowerClient automatizza l’installazione e l’aggiornamento delle applicazioni lato client via HTTPS, e supporta sia i progetti client/server sia quelli cloud. I file del client Tsono criptati, firmati digitalmente e verificati nella loro integrità prima di essere eseguiti. Vengono così eliminati i grattacapi e i costi legati alla creazione di installer, all’installazione dei programmi presso gli utenti, e al tenere aggiornate le applicazioni.
- Compilazione con versioni multiple del Runtime – L’IDE PowerBuilder adesso supporta il cambio della versione di runtime utilizzata per far girare, per il debug e per comilare la Tua applicazione. Puoi passare avanti e indietro tra le major version, le revisioni, e le maintenance releases. In questo modo gli sviluppatori possono beneficiare dei miglioramenti dell’IDE senza impattare sul runtime, manutenere più progetti con varie versioni di runtime, e ritornare a versioni di runtime precedenti.
- Apache ECharts – Apache ECharts adessi si integrano facilmente con PowerBuilder e con la tecnologia della DataWindow. Viene proposta una applicazione demo per mostrare come è possibile arricchire facilmente PowerBuilder con i moderni grafici interattivi. Visualizza i tuoi dati con nuovi stili di grafico, come ad esempio gauges, heatmap, candlestick, scatter, e funnel. Quindi analizza velocemente, segmenta, e filtra i dati dei grafici.
- Miglioramento del Web Browser – Il web browser incorporato Chromium è stato migliorato per poter integrare facilmente JavaScript con PowerScript, in modo sia asincrono che sincrono. Oltre a poter mostrare con sicurezza contenuti web, gli sviluppatori possono arricchire le loro app con nuove possibilità visuali e con la funzionalità del JavaScript. Supporta anche l’autenticazione di tipo basic oppure digest.
- Microsoft UI Automation – Adesso PowerBuilder supporta il framework Microsoft UI Automation, rendendo le Tue applicazioni più accessibili e offrendoti la possibilità di automatizzare i processi. Semplicemente configura le proprietà di accessibilità per beneficiare degli strumenti di testing automatizzato, di RPA, e per la compliance con le norme di accessibilità.
- Miglioramenti del Git – L’integrazione di Git è stata potenziata, ed ora Ti permette di eseguire complesse operazion Git dall’interno dell’IDE PowerBuilder. Crea e cambia facilmente i branches, risolvi i conflitti, e controlla i log dettagliati degli errori, migliorando la tua produttività nell’uso di Git con i Tuoi progetti PowerScript.
Miglioramenti nello sviluppo C#
- Supporto di .NET Core 3.1 – SnapDevelop adesso supporta lo sviluppo di progetti C# basati su .NET Core 3.1. Oltre ad essere una versione LTS, .NET Core 3.1 include molti miglioramenti, come le nuove API JSON, il supporto per ARM 64, C# 8.0, etc. etc.
- Programmazione Asincrona – I nuovi metodi asincroni CRUD inclusi nel .NET DataStore permettono agli sviluppatori di creare applicazioni più scalabili e responsive. Sono supportati l’asynchronous query & saving, l’embedded e il dynamic SQL, e lo scaffolding di servizi e controller asincroni.
- Debugging Avanzato – Fai il debug dei Tuoi progetti C# in SnapDevelop in manierta più semplice e veloce. Il debugger è stato reingegnerizzato e supporta anche il debugging asincrono ed i progetti multi-threaded.
- Miglioramenti del Docker – Puoi facilmente completare l’installazione del Tuo Docker, gestire l’image ed il container, ed il Docker compose dall’interno del nuovo Docker Explorer di SnapDevelop.
Miglioramenti per i Database
- Progetti in PowerScript – E’ stato integrato il supporto del nuovo driver Microsoft OLE DB (MSOLEDBSQL), che supporta SQL Server 2012 – 2019 e sostituisce il client nativo (SQLNCLI) che è stato deprecato da Microsoft.
- Progrtti in C# – E’ stata ampliata la compatibilità dei database, con l’aggiunta del supporto dei database cloud-specific Amazon Aurora and Azure, di SAP HANA, e di Sybase ASE.
San Francisco, 23 Aprile 2020
PowerBuilder 2019 R2 segue la roadmap di Appeon con lo scopo di modernizzare la UI, le funzionalità e l’architettura delle Vostre applicazioni con il minor sforzo possibile. Se usate ancora una vecchia versione SAP o Sybase di PowerBuilder, oppure se è da molto tempo che non usate più PowerBuilder, questa è la versione giusta da provare e testare!
Raccomandiamo di iniziare con le seguenti killer features:
1. Modernizzazione immediata dell’UI delle Vostre applicazioni
L’UI Theme è un approccio di modernizzazione dell’UI che non obbliga a scrivere codice, e ciò aiuta ad aggiornare il look & feel delle Vostre applicazioni in modo molto veloce. Avete la possibilità di applicare immediatamente uno dei temi professionali già pronti (ad esempio il dark theme), oppure potete personalizzare un tema in base alle Vostre esigenze. In PowerBuilder 2019 R2 abbiamo potenziato enormemente questa funzionalità.
2. Costruzione di una REST API in 120 secondi
Sfruttando la tecnologia della DataWindow in .NET, insieme a vari strumenti di generazione codice C#, potete sviluppare e testare una REST API in appena 120 secondi. La scrittura del codice in C# è incentrato su una DataWindow non visuale (ad esempio .NET DataStore), che virtualmente elimina la curva di apprendimento ed accelera in modo drammatico lo sviluppo. Per saperne di più
3. Aggiornamento del Vostro Database
Sono supportate le versioni più recenti dei maggiori e pià diffusi database, insieme ad altre nuove funzionalità importanti. Ad esempio, ora sono supportati Microsoft SQL Server 2019 ed Oracle 19c, e per quanto riguarda Oracle, pora sono supportati i data types NCLOB, NCHAR, NVARCHAR2, BINARY_DOUBLE, BINARY_FLOAT, TIMESTAMP, XMLTYPE. Per saperne di più
San Francisco, 30 maggio 2019
PowerBuilder 2019 aggiunge alla produttività, caratteristica distintiva di PowerBuilder, lo sviluppo C#, WebAPI & Assembly. Viene rilasciata anche una soluzione di migrazione C# (framework e tools) così che si possa far leva sugli asset del codice esistente. Lo sviluppo delle app client con PowerScript riprende vigore con le nuove tecnologie per l’interfaccia urtente e l’architettura cloud.
- Empowering PowerBuilder with C# features
- New UI theme
- Incorporating TX Text Control as built-in editor
- New CompressorObject and ExtractorObject objects
- New Import & Export JSON functions
- New JSON format
- New Windows 10 style icons and small pictures
- Enhanced RESTClient object
- Enhanced HTTPClient object
- Enhanced JSONPackage object
- Enhanced JSONGenerator
- Enhanced JSONParser object
- 64-bit enhancements
- PBC enhancements
- New online installer — Appeon Installer
PowerBuilder 2017
La nuova generazione di PowerBuilder inizia il 30 Giugno 2017
Appeon ha lavorato per creare la nuova generazione di PowerBuilder che mantiene tutto quel che lo ha reso lo strumento di sviluppo preferito da migliaia di sviluppatori, ma che aggiunge ai Vostri progetti nuovi standard di sviluppo consolidati e le nuove tecnologie disponibili.
Con le nuove versioni, il vostri progetti di sviluppo potranno finalmente avvalersi delle tecnologie di pubblicazione su mobile e cloud, di uno sviluppo test-driven e di una integrazione continuativa.
PowerBuilder Vi permette di creare applicazioni business migliori e più performanti per Windows, iOS ed Android.
Visual IDE
Un Visual IDE semplice, intuitivo e visual-driven IDE con funzionalità di rapid preview
Potente ORM (Object Relational mapping)
L’accesso e la manipolazione di dati complessi non necessita praticamente di codifica ed è database-agnostic
Rich Library
Un set di oggetti espandibile, e in più l’accesso alle funzioni device-level
Progetti Universali
I progetti possono essere pubblicati su tutti gli OS e i device, oppure ottimizzati per specifiche combinazioni
Cloud-Ready
I componenti server-side vengono pubblicati sul cloud, e sono supportate le WebAPI
Tecnologia .NET
Sfruttando un motore middle tier .NET, è possibile sfruttare o esporre non-visual assemblies
Le Novità in PowerBuilder 2019
Questa release è stata progettata avendo in mente la facilità di aggiornamento da parte degli utenti SAP Sybase esistenti. La versione Standard (Desktop Target) contiene alcuni miglioramenti profondi di cui c’era bisogno da tempo, e viene introdotta la nuovissima versione mobile (mobile target).
Aggiorna il tuo OS ed il tuo DB Sia l’IDE PowerBuilder che le applicazioni desktop possono adesso essere installati su Windows 10 e Windows Server 2016. Sono supportati i più aggiornati driver per le più recenti versioni dei database SQL Server, Oracle, SQL Anywhere ed ASE. Genera facilmente file PDF Genera file PDF direttamente dall’interno di PowerBuilder. Non c’è più bisogno di complicate installazioni di stampanti PDF, né di comprare costose librerie PDF. Il nuovo PowerBuilder include semplici API con opzioni di stampa flessibili. Go Mobile and Cloud Viene introdotto il nuovo Mobile Cloud App target (grazie alla tecnologia di Appeon Mobile). La maggior parte delle funzionalità di PowerBuilder e i plug-in di Apache Cordova sono supportati. E’ possibile compliare per iOS e Android, e sui principali e più diffusi cloud providers.